Failure to Boot After a SDRAM Upgrade or Replacement

Note
Only the NSE-100 uses SDRAM SODIMMs. The NSE-150 DDR-SODIMMs are not field-upgradeable.
If, after a SDRAM upgrade or replacement, the system fails to boot properly, or if the console terminal
displays a checksum or memory error, ensure that the SODIMM is installed correctly. If necessary, shut
down the system and remove the network services engine. Check the SODIMM by looking straight down
on it and then at eye level. If the SODIMM appears to stick out or rest in the socket at an odd angle,
remove it and reinsert it. Then replace the network services engine and reboot the system for another
installation check.
If after several attempts the system fails to restart properly, contact a service representative for
assistance. Before you call, note any error messages, unusual LED states, or other indications that might
help solve the problem.

Using the show version Command

Use the show version command to display the configuration of the system hardware including the NSE
and the software version.
The following example of the show version command identifies an NSE-100 installed in a Cisco 7304
router:
